Output 6fe674405b2be2c45cdd661f6a23ceebfbae5f89ea271343b0da5c1d25ee6400:60

value
8318575
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3c9fdae2d2f642f9cdbd2ce49f3619fc31c55ba9 OP_EQUAL
address
37DZxyXGubyMYUj44pXE4hnT3ZsvVsMveB
transaction
6fe674405b2be2c45cdd661f6a23ceebfbae5f89ea271343b0da5c1d25ee6400
spent
true